If you are looking for the best investing platform in India with a heavy emphasis on **research, expert advisory, and market analysis**, the choice generally comes down to whether you want a modern platform that offers free basic research, or an established, premium full-service broker known for institutional-grade data. Here is a breakdown of the top platforms categorized by their research capabilities: ### 1. Best for In-Depth & Institutional Research: Motilal Oswal If your primary requirement is comprehensive fundamental and technical research, Motilal Oswal remains an industry leader. * **Research Quality:** They cover over 260+ stocks across 21+ sectors, delivering daily actionable reports, sector-wise analysis, and macroeconomic insights. Their annual Wealth Creation Studies are highly regarded in the Indian financial ecosystem. * **Best For:** Investors who want high-conviction long-term ideas and detailed multi-page PDF reports. * **Cost:** High brokerage charges (percentage-based) unless you negotiate a specific flat-rate plan. ### 2. Best for Balanced Research & Low Cost: Angel One Angel One has successfully blended the features of a traditional full-service broker with the competitive flat fees of a modern discount broker. * **Research Quality:** They offer **free fundamental research reports** and stock recommendations directly inside the app. They also feature *ARQ Prime*, an AI-driven investment engine that suggests curated stock portfolios. * **Best For:** Self-directed investors who want solid advisory tips without paying high percentage-based brokerage commissions. * **Cost:** Flat ₹20 per trade for intraday/F&O; equity delivery is highly competitive (often free or deeply discounted for the initial period). ### 3. Best for Bank-Backed Stability & Advisory: ICICI Direct / HDFC Securities For conservative investors who prioritize security, a "3-in-1" account (linking banking, demat, and trading) is incredibly convenient. * **Research Quality:** Both platforms have massive, dedicated research desks that provide daily stock picks, IPO analysis, and wealth management advice. * **Best For:** High Net-Worth Individuals (HNIs) and long-term investors who prefer a single ecosystem and trust bank-grade security. * **Cost:** Higher brokerage fees compared to discount brokers, though they now offer cheaper tiered plans (like ICICI's *iValue* plan) to compete with discount apps. ### 4. Best Discount Brokers (With Third-Party Research Integrations) If you prefer platforms like **Zerodha Kite** or **Groww** because of their clean interfaces and zero/low brokerage, note that they **do not provide in-house stock recommendations**.
